Barcelona is back. The Catalan giants have roared into the new LaLiga season with a statement. A 7-0 demolition of Real Valladolid showcased their intent. Raphinha was the architect of this rout, scoring a hat-trick and providing two assists. The match was a symphony of skill, teamwork, and dominance.

From the first whistle, Barcelona set the tone. The players moved like a well-oiled machine. Raphinha opened the scoring in the 20th minute. He danced past defenders, his feet a blur. The ball found the back of the net, igniting the crowd. The Estadi Olímpic Lluís Companys erupted.

Just four minutes later, Robert Lewandowski doubled the lead. The Polish striker, ever the predator, pounced on a loose ball. His finish was clinical. Barcelona was in control, and they weren’t done yet. Jules Koundé added a third just before halftime. The defense of Valladolid crumbled under pressure.

The second half was a continuation of the onslaught. Raphinha struck again, showcasing his flair. He wasn’t just a scorer; he was a playmaker. His vision on the field was remarkable. He assisted Dani Olmo, who scored the fifth goal. The connection between the players was electric.

Ferran Torres joined the party, netting the sixth. The scoreboard flashed 6-0, a testament to Barcelona's dominance. Raphinha capped off his stellar performance with his third goal. The hat-trick was a personal milestone, but it meant more for the team.

Barcelona’s performance was a clear message to their rivals. They are not just participants; they are contenders. With four wins from four matches, they sit atop the LaLiga standings. Villarreal trails behind, and Real Madrid is left in the dust.
